The former Indian pacer, Atul Wassan, has dropped a bombshell by shockingly revealing that he wants Pakistan to win against Rohit Sharma’s army during the upcoming encounter on February 23 at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ium in the United Arab Emirates (UAE).
Pakistan will fight hard to keep themselves alive in the tournament after their 60-run defeat in the opening clash against New Zealand. The Blue Brigade, on the other hand, started in a powerful fashion with the six-wicket victory over Bangladesh.
Atul Wassan predicts Pakistan’s victory against India in Champions Trophy 2025
A defeat against India will almost eliminate Pakistan from the eight-team tournament. They will then require plenty of permutations and combinations to work in their favor to win the semifinal tickets. But Wassan feels that for the tournament to remain exciting, it will be valuable for the Green Brigade to come on the right side of the line.

“I want Pakistan to win because it will be fun, tournament-wise. If you don't let Pakistan win, then what will you do? If Pakistan wins, then it becomes a contest. There should be an equal fight.” The former Indian pacer revealed.
The former right-arm medium pacer lauds India’s batting depth in the playing eleven. He reckoned that the blue brigade had done the right thing in selecting five spinners, keeping in mind the slow and low surfaces of Dubai, as he addressed it as the best team.
“You have a lot of good batters: Shubman (Gill), Rohit (Sharma), Virat (Kohli). You are batting until number eight in Axar Patel. Rohit has picked five spinners, and this team is best for Dubai. Have faith in what you have and move ahead.” The Delhi-born expressed this during a recent interaction on ANI.
Ex-India pacer slams Gautam Gambhir for leaving Rishabh Pant in the playing eleven
The former pacer of the Indian side has criticized the management’s decision to bench Rishabh Pant for a long duration in the format. He feels that it would hurt the keeper’s confidence. Wassan also added that the opposition would always be scared of players like Pant in the playing line-up.
“You let Bangladesh score 228 runs after they were 35/5. Big teams will eat you up if you let them do that. Gautam Gambhir is picking his team. I am just very upset that Rishabh Pant is not playing. I don’t know why. What is going on? Pant is a mercurial player whom the other team is scared of. Because they know that he can win matches on his own.” Atul Wasan expressed this in an interview with ANI.

"KL Rahul is a great player. But I don’t know what they see in him that he is playing Test matches, ODIs, and everything. Rishabh Pant is on the bench now. This is how you ruin players. If you put a good player in a situation where he keeps thinking whether he will play or not, that player will go from hero to zero.” The former pacer claimed.
India gears for mouth-watering clash against Pakistan
The blue brigade hasn’t enjoyed the same success over Pakistan in the Champions Trophy, with two victories in five clashes. But their success in the ICC 50-over format over the Green Brigade is incredible.
Even in the last 50-over clash between the two sides during the 2023 World Cup, Rohit Sharma had a comfortable victory in Ahmedabad. Eyes will be on Babar Azam and Virat Kohli for the electrifying clash. Both the batters had a tough time in the recent 50-over games.
